On The Fringe has all the info about what’s happening in the arts and culture scene across Waterford city and county. Gemma has her finger on the pulse when it comes to theatre, music, festivals and more. Listen to some of her interviews here.

The Piatti String Quartet returns to The Dr Mary Strangman Large Room, WaterfordWednesday, Mar 11th 2026 at 7:30 pm for an evening of cinematic classics. The UK-based quartet will perform pieces composed for film by Glass, Shostakovich, Radiohead guitarist Jonny Greenwood and more. Michael Trainor chats with Gemma about what the audience can expect.
